The best Indian courtroom dramas you must watch

Courtroom dramas have always been some of the most exciting movies to watch. These films show us the world of justice, moral choices, and legal fights that make us think deeply about right and wrong. Indian cinema has given us many amazing courtroom drama movies that not only entertain but also teach us important lessons about society.

Why Indian Courtroom Dramas Are So Special

Indian courtroom dramas deal with real problems that people face every day. These movies talk about social justice, women’s rights, corruption, and discrimination. Many of these films are based on true stories, which makes them even more powerful and meaningful.

Must-Watch Indian Courtroom Drama Movies

1. Jai Bhim (2021)

This is one of the best courtroom drama movies ever made in India. The story follows a tribal woman whose husband goes missing after police arrest him. Actor Suriya plays a lawyer who fights for justice and exposes police cruelty. This movie shows how poor and marginalized people suffer in our legal system.

2. Pink (2016)

Pink is a powerful Hindi courtroom drama that talks about women’s safety and consent. Amitabh Bachchan plays a retired lawyer who helps three young women who are falsely accused. The movie’s famous message “No means no” started important conversations about respecting women.

3. Jolly LLB Series (2013, 2017)

These movies are funny yet serious courtroom dramas. They show small-town lawyers taking on big cases and fighting corruption in the legal system. The Jolly LLB series makes us laugh while also making us think about problems in our courts.

4. Shahid (2013)

Based on a true story, Shahid tells us about a brave lawyer who helped innocent people wrongly accused of terrorism. Rajkummar Rao gives an amazing performance in this underrated legal drama that shows how hard it is to get justice when the system is unfair.

5. Section 375 (2019)

This courtroom drama Hindi movie deals with difficult topics like consent and how laws can be misused. The movie shows both sides of a rape case through two opposing lawyers, making viewers think carefully about complex legal issues.

Why These Movies Matter

Courtroom dramas are popular because they show real human emotions and struggles. They help us understand how our legal system works and what problems it has. These movies also teach us about important social issues like gender equality, caste discrimination, and corruption.

More Great Indian Courtroom Movies

Other excellent courtroom drama movies include Mulk (2018), which deals with religious prejudice, and Court (2014), which shows the slow reality of our legal system. OMG – Oh My God! (2012) uses court scenes to question blind faith, while Rustom (2016) is based on a famous real murder case.
